I am a volunteer at an animal shelter and I am utterly disgusted at the gall of this establishment to advertise that it has an adoptable animal program in place. Not only were the half dozen or so mixed breed terrier-retriever-hound puppies and dogs on display quarantined in glass boxes on mesh (which is awful for their feet and also during a CRUCIAL AGE for behavioral training it is teaching the puppies to urinate and defecate wherever they can) but they all were EXTREMELY under socialized, malnourished, frightened of people and just cowering in corners, and on top of that had the audacity to say that the adoption fee for all of these dogs was $700. This is absurd and thievery. $700 is an average cost of a pup from a private breeder where you could expect to meet the sire and dam, a detailed print of their heritage, possible akc registration, medical history, vaccinations, etc. You can expect a $700 dog to be well socialized to humans, started to be taught potty trained, played with, etc. Meanwhile at your local animal shelter, you can expect a homeless dog to range anywhere from $100-250 to cover the cost of neutering/vaccinations/medical checkups.It is safe to say that any cost larger than this is strictly for profit. Dogs come in with all sorts of backgrounds: strays, owner surrenders, neglect cases, all of which have their own individual needs. To be brutally honest, the animals for adoption at this pet supply store (and any pet store that dont explicitly list the shelter and adoption fee in question that they are helping) are most likely from a puppy mill. If you are willing to spend $700 on a puppy for your child, do yourself a favor and seek out a reputable breeder who cares about the health of their dogs. Otherwise please please adopt from a real animal shelter and donate to them. Millions of animals are killed every year in the United States because there arent enough homes for them all. Volunteers give so much of their time and energy to make sure dogs and cats can be healthy and friendly and find the best possible homes for them, for very little payoff (often putting themselves into debt! Theres a reason why local shelters are always asking for donations.)

TL;DR: Please research your pets needs before acquiring them, wherever you get them from, and do not count on this store to know the needs of their animals.The axolotls they keep are in tanks with gravel and areas of strong water flow, both of which are incredibly hazardous and stressful for these creatures. Axolotls eat anything smaller than their head, so gravel is an eventual death sentence, slow and painful. Strong water flows are a source of stress and can break their gills. I have a soft spot for axolotls, so I felt compelled to try to save one on deaths door, just a few months old with no gills and unbearably thin. The associate initially tried to fish him out with a net before I stopped him, because nets will tear off their gills and legs when theyre that young. If you stop reading here, the point is that a pet store should know its animals better than to break a species three most important and basic rules of keeping them alive.Im happy to say hes doing much better, despite my initial fears that he had ingested a rock and would die no matter what I did. He was so weak, I dont think he had the strength to eat a rock anyway. A week later I went back for his tank mate, who was doing slightly better than the one I took home, but he had been sold and two new albinos were in his place. I politely informed the three associates that the gravel will literally kill any axolotl that lives in the tank for long enough, and that the high-flow filters destroy their gills and make it hard for them to breathe. At least one of them seemed genuinely receptive and said she would inform her manager, which is why this is a two-star review instead of just one.I hope the tank conditions have been changed, or better yet, that they have stopped carrying axolotls altogether, but I cant bring myself to go back, and theres nothing I can do. Buying from them just encourages them to get more.Ive fixated on the axolotls, but if you go here, pay attention to the other animals too. All in all, Im so glad I have my little lotl now, but I wish I had found him under other circumstances.
